I have some GitHub repositories, and as some of you probably noticed, I've put a lot of work into the t_games one. So I got a pull request from someone I never heard of saying he fixed some typos in the readme. He did change one typo, and changed one word to a synonym. Then he added in some "badges," some of which were wrong (are badges at all important on GitHub?).

One of the badges was "all contributors" which I found more info on here. It says:

all contributors Wrote:People are giving themselves and their free time to contribute to open source projects in so many ways, so we believe everyone should be praised for their contributions (code or not).

In general I don't have a problem giving credit where credit is due. I put an extensive credit list in the t_games interface for that purpose. But this just seems to catch GitHub contributors, and not all of my contributors are on GitHub.

I just use GitHub for my narrow little purposes, and I don't really have a clue about the broader community or whatever. But this just smells like some guy who wants to get his name as a contributor on as many projects as possible, and force people to give him credit by dragging them into this "all contributors" thing. Is that a fair assessment, or am I missing something?
